1. Numerical Measures. A stock sells at $15 per share. a. What is the EPS for the company if it has a P/E ratio of 20? Answer in text box below (drag corner of text box to enlarge as needed): b. If the company's dividend yield is 3 percent, what is its dividend per share? Answer in text box below (drag corner of text box to enlarge as needed): c. What is the book value of the company if the price-to-book ratio is 1.5 and it has 100,000 shares of stock outstanding? Answer in text box below (drag corner of text box to enlarge as needed)
